About Shannon Xiao Cui
Shannon Xiao Cui is a Senior Product Designer at Carta, where she focuses on simplicity in product design. With experience at notable companies like Dropbox and Oracle, she combines a data-driven approach with deep empathy for users.
Work at Carta
Shannon Xiao Cui has been employed at Carta as a Senior Product Designer since 2023. In this role, she focuses on designing products that prioritize simplicity and user experience. Her current work involves developing a venture capital product, where she applies her design philosophy and expertise to create intuitive solutions for users.
Previous Experience in Product Design
Before joining Carta, Shannon worked at Dropbox as a Senior Product Designer from 2021 to 2023. During her tenure, she contributed to various design projects that enhanced user engagement and streamlined workflows. Prior to Dropbox, she served as a Product Designer at Wonolo for one year, where she focused on improving the platform's usability. Her experience also includes a three-year position as a User Experience Designer at Oracle, where she worked on multiple projects in the San Francisco Bay Area.
Education and Expertise
Shannon holds a Master’s Degree in Integrated Innovation for Products and Services from Carnegie Mellon University, where she studied from 2015 to 2017. She also earned a Bachelor’s Degree in Industrial and Product Design from Shandong Institute of Architecture and Engineering, completing her studies from 2011 to 2015. Her educational background provides her with a strong foundation in design principles and user-centered methodologies.
Background in User Experience
Shannon's career in design began with internships and research roles. She worked as a UX Design Intern at Axxess for three months in 2016 and as a Research Assistant at Carnegie Mellon University's HCI Institute for four months in the same year. These early experiences contributed to her understanding of user needs and informed her approach to product design.
